Chapter 7 Bankruptcy

West Hills residents with consumer debt can have unsecured debt discharged in Chapter 7. A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Lawyer can advise you on what debt may be discharged and what assets are exempt. You must have income that is below the state median for your household or have disposable income that is not above a certain amount.

Once you take a debt education class and provide certain financial documents, your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Lawyer will file a petition containing details on your financial affairs. After filing, you and your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Lawyer meet with the trustee to review the petition.

With secured debt, your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Lawyer can explain that you can reaffirm, redeem or surrender collateralized property without further obligations.

In the majority of cases, a discharge of your unsecured debt in granted in 4 to 6 months after filing.

Chapter 11 Bankruptcy

If your West Hills corporation or partnership is struggling to pay creditors, see a Chapter 11 Bankruptcy Lawyer about how Chapter 11 works. Under Chapter 11, your business can continue to operate after filing but only after your Chapter 11 Bankruptcy Lawyer submits a reorganization plan that sets forth how creditors are to paid and is confirmed.

The plan also contains a blueprint for restructuring the business that may include selling off assets, downsizing, hiring certain professionals and renegotiating leases, licenses and contracts. These and other major business decisions must be court approved.

For small businesses, they will be under greater court supervision but can avoid some of the formalities. If a West Hills bankruptcy lawyer advises, individual debtors who are unable to file under Chapter 7 or 13 can file Chapter 11.
